Two chunky lip balms I love

It's no surprise to regular readers to know I've tried a lot of lip balms and am pretty fussy with them. It's rare that I love a balm from the second I apply it, but that's exactly what happened when I tried Drunk Elephant Lippe and Sol de Janeiro Brazilian Kiss Cupuacu Lip Butter.    



I don't usually purchase chunky balms as I find them too inconvenient. They don't fit in my pocket, they're not convenient to carry around, they're just annoying. However, I'm willing to make an exception for these two.  


They are both perfection in a lip balm. They're creamy, hydrating and soothing with a gorgeous scent. I really can't decide which I love more.


Drunk Elephant Lippe smells and tastes like cranberry. It's not a flavour that I've ever had in a lip balm before and is surprisingly lovely. The finish is smooth and glossy. Lippe contains green tea leaf and vitamin C which help to smooth fine lines.

After falling in love with the Sol de Janeiro Brazilian Bum Bum cream scent, I had to buy the lip butter. It smells just as amazing as the Bum Bum cream. I adore the salted caramel pistachio scent, it's addictive!
Brazilian Kiss has no flavour (unfortunately!) but I'll forgive that due to how soothing and healing it is. The finish is a subtle shine, not glossy like Lippe. 

If you are having trouble choosing between the two here's a run down.
Lippe is flavoured and glossy. It looks great alone or over the top of lipsticks. 
Brazilian Kiss is fragranced with no flavour and works well under lipstick.

At $26 each these balms aren't cheap, but they're double the size of a regular lip balm and a dream to use.
